I know it's not actually Sean Connery's model, but it's *my* 14060M, and my first Rolex. From this an angle it looks pretty good imo.

Shout out to thosue looking for one, this is Watch Gecko's "Genuine Vintage Bond US Type NATO by Geckota" unlike 99% of what I found online, it's actually the correct blue/maroon/olive without any extraneous buckles or keepers. Shipped super fast too. I love it.
